What is the difference between Remote Research Development Chef vs Remote Food Product Developer?

AspectRemote Research Development ChefRemote Food Product Developer
CredentialsCulinary degree, food safety certificationsFood science or related degree, certifications may vary
Work EnvironmentKitchen, R&D labs, remote collaborationLaboratories, kitchens, remote teams
Industry UsageRestaurants, food brands, culinary innovationFood companies, product innovation, packaging
Search & Comparison IntentUnderstanding culinary R&D roles, recipes, menu developmentFood product creation, formulation, packaging

The Remote Research Development Chef focuses on culinary innovation, recipe development, and menu creation, often requiring culinary degrees and kitchen experience. In contrast, the Remote Food Product Developer emphasizes food formulation, product testing, and packaging, typically with a food science background. Both roles involve remote collaboration but serve different aspects of food industry innovation.

How does a Remote Research Development Chef effectively collaborate with in-house culinary teams and product developers?

A Remote Research Development Chef typically uses video conferencing, collaborative platforms, and shared documentation to stay closely aligned with in-house teams. Regular virtual meetings are scheduled to review project progress, exchange feedback, and troubleshoot recipe challenges. Detailed notes, standardized recipes, and visual presentations are shared to ensure clear communication. Although remote, the chef is expected to maintain a proactive approach, adapting to time zone differences and responding promptly to queries, ensuring seamless integration with on-site culinary and product development staff.

What is a Remote Research Development Chef?

A Remote Research Development Chef is a culinary professional who specializes in creating, testing, and refining recipes or food products, often for restaurants, food manufacturers, or brands, while working remotely. They typically collaborate with other chefs, product developers, and clients through virtual meetings and digital platforms. Their responsibilities include researching food trends, developing new menu items or products, and ensuring recipes meet specific quality, safety, and cost standards. Remote R&D chefs use their culinary expertise and creativity to innovate, even when not physically present in a traditional kitchen or laboratory. This role requires strong communication, adaptability, and proficiency with technology to collaborate and share results remotely.

What are the key skills and qualifications needed to thrive as a Remote Research Development Chef, and why are they important?

To thrive as a Remote Research Development Chef, you need expert culinary skills, a solid understanding of food science, and experience in recipe development, typically supported by a culinary degree or equivalent experience. Familiarity with digital collaboration tools, sensory analysis software, and food safety certifications like ServSafe is commonly required. Creativity, strong communication, and adaptability are crucial soft skills for innovating recipes and effectively collaborating with remote teams. These skills ensure successful product development, efficient teamwork, and the ability to meet diverse client and consumer needs in a remote environment.

Job description

SciTec, a wholly owned subsidiary of Firefly Aerospace, is a dynamic non-traditional defense contractor that delivers advanced technologies in support of U.S. National Security and Defense. For the past forty-five plus years, we have supported Department of Defense customers by developing innovative remote sensing algorithms, tools, and techniques to deliver world-class data exploitation capabilities supporting missile defense; intelligence, surveillance, & reconnaissance; space domain awareness; and aircraft survivability missions.

Important Notice: SciTec exclusively works on U.S. government contracts that require U.S. citizenship for all employees. SciTec cannot sponsor or assume sponsorship of employee work visas of any type. Further, U.S. citizenship is a requirement to obtain and keep a security clearance. Applicants that do not meet these requirements will not be considered.

SciTec has immediate opportunities for talented software & algorithm developers and engineers to support programs focusing on low-latency data processing, fusion, and tracking algorithms for exploitation of remote sensing systems. Our ideal candidate will work well in multiple software languages as part of a rapid pace, collaborative, small-team environment consisting of Scientists, Engineers, and Developers and be able to prototype and develop advanced algorithms leading to eventual integration in C++ on Linux operating systems as part of government frameworks.

Responsibilities

  • Lead the research, development, and maturation of advanced numerical algorithms for remote sensing data exploitation across multi-modal sensor systems (e.g., EO/IR, SAR, RF)
  • Design, implement, and optimize high-performance algorithms in Python and C++, with a focus on scalability, efficiency, and operational robustness in mission environments
  • Architect and develop end-to-end signal processing, image processing, and data exploitation pipelines from prototype through production deployment
  • Advance modeling, simulation, and machine learning toolchains, including development of reusable frameworks and infrastructure to support algorithm evaluation and integration
  • Define and execute quantitative performance assessments of algorithms and sensor systems, including error characterization, sensitivity analysis, and validation against real-world data
  • Collaborate cross-functionally with software engineers, system architects, and mission stakeholders to integrate algorithms into operational systems and ensure mission alignment
  • Provide technical leadership within Agile development teams, including mentoring junior engineers, driving best practices, and contributing to shared codebases and tools
  • Support proposal efforts, technical roadmaps, and customer engagements by articulating algorithmic approaches and differentiators
  • Ensure compliance with mission assurance, security, and software quality standards applicable to DoD environments
  • Other duties as assigned

Requirements

  • Bachelor's or Master's degree in Applied Mathematics, Physics, Electrical Engineering, Computer Science, or related technical field
  • 2+ years of experience developing numerical algorithms for signal processing, image processing, or sensor data exploitation
  • Demonstrated expertise in developing and implementing algorithms in Python and C++
  • Strong foundation in numerical methods, linear algebra, probability/statistics, and optimization techniques
  • Experience working with real-world sensor data (e.g., EO/IR, SAR, RF, or multi-modal systems)
  • Proven ability to evaluate algorithm performance, including error analysis, validation, and benchmarking
  • Experience working in Linux-based development environments and modern software development practices (version control, testing, CI/CD)
  • Ability to work effectively in Agile or iterative development environments
  • Strong written and verbal communication skills, including ability to convey complex technical concepts to diverse stakeholders
  • U.S. Citizenship with ability to obtain and maintain a DoD security clearance (active clearance preferred)

Candidates who have any of the following skills will be preferred

  • PhD in Applied Mathematics, Physics, Electrical Engineering, or related field
  • Experience with advanced signal/image processing techniques (e.g., detection, tracking, estimation, inverse problems, or computer vision)
  • Familiarity with machine learning frameworks and integration of ML models into operational pipelines
  • Experience optimizing algorithms for performance (e.g., parallel computing, GPU acceleration, memory optimization)
  • Knowledge of DoD or Intelligence Community mission systems, especially related to remote sensing or space-based sensors
  • Experience transitioning algorithms from research/prototype to production/operational environments
  • Familiarity with containerization and orchestration technologies (e.g., Docker, Kubernetes)
  • Experience with modeling and simulation environments supporting sensor system development
  • Prior experience leading technical efforts or mentoring junior engineers
  • Active DoD security clearance
